Kausa Bangar is a Rural village located in Kaladhungi, Nainital, Uttarakhand.
The total population of Kausa Bangar is 43.
Kausa Bangar village comprises 9 households.
The literacy rate in Kausa Bangar is 80.5%. Among the literate population of 33, there are 14 literate males and 19 literate females.
In Kausa Bangar, there are 19 males and 24 females, with a sex ratio of 1263 females per 1000 males.
There are 2 children (4.7% of population), comprising 2 boys and 0 girls.
The total number of workers in Kausa Bangar is 12, with 12 main workers and 0 marginal workers.

Kausa Bangar is located in Uttarakhand state, Nainital district, and falls under Kaladhungi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 55531 and LGD code is 55531.
